                    Oh and BTW, Link is already down ?! We are not even in december !!!

                    @cqoicebordel: where is it you don't get Link to work?

                    • The planned shut down date is December 14
                    • When Link is closed, nothing will be removed from your browsers - your data (including notes) will remain in your browser, but it will not sync between your devices, and you cannot access your data on https://link.opera.com

                        It is a real pity: The new sync Service does not carry over any of the notes I have kept in my Bookmarks pages.
                        Also the separate Notes where really useful, even so not synced to any phones (I organized my Wedding with it and my wife was able to see all I have arranged and vice versa...) and stacking the tabs is still not supported on the new browser which I made extensive use off in Opera....

                        For people with the same problem as me (at least for the notes in the bookmarks section):
                        Export your Bookmarks from the Browser as HTML, at least this way you can create a link to this html page in the new browser, open it and you will still be able to search the page for the notes as they are actually exported when you export the Bookmarks as html.
                        Works, but it will be a pain to keep updated in the future...
